首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

标记为临时的OpenHFT历史记录队列写入字段

OpenHFT是一个开源的高性能计算库,专注于解决金融领域的高频交易和实时数据处理问题。它提供了一系列的工具和组件,其中之一就是历史记录队列(Historical Chronicle Queue)。

历史记录队列是OpenHFT库中的一个功能模块,用于高效地写入和读取数据。它采用了内存映射文件的方式,将数据存储在操作系统的虚拟内存中,从而实现了极低的延迟和高吞吐量。

历史记录队列的主要特点包括:

  1. 高性能:历史记录队列利用了内存映射文件和零拷贝技术,能够以非常高的速度写入和读取数据,适用于对延迟和吞吐量要求极高的场景。
  2. 持久化存储:历史记录队列将数据持久化地存储在磁盘上,即使系统重启或崩溃,数据也不会丢失。这对于金融领域的实时数据处理非常重要。
  3. 多线程支持:历史记录队列能够同时支持多个线程对数据进行读写操作,保证数据的一致性和并发性能。
  4. 低延迟:由于采用了内存映射文件和零拷贝技术,历史记录队列能够实现非常低的读写延迟,适用于对实时性要求较高的应用场景。
  5. 灵活的数据模型:历史记录队列支持多种数据类型的存储,包括原始字节、对象、枚举等,可以根据具体需求选择合适的数据模型。

OpenHFT提供了一系列的产品和组件,可以与历史记录队列结合使用,以满足不同场景下的需求。例如,Chronicle Map可以用于高性能的键值存储,Chronicle Queue可以用于高性能的消息队列,Chronicle Engine可以用于构建分布式计算系统等。

更多关于OpenHFT历史记录队列的详细信息和使用示例,请参考腾讯云的官方文档:OpenHFT历史记录队列

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券